function check_form_add_inscription(){
	
	var mask1='^[a-zA-Z0-9-\.\_]+@[a-zA-Z0-9-\.\_]+[\.]{1}[a-zA-Z0-9]{2,4}$';	

	// Verification du champ bagad
	if (document.form_insc.inscription_bagad.value==""){	
		alert ('Veuillez entrer votre bagad.');}

	// Verification du champ email
	else if (document.form_insc.contact_email.value ==""){ 
		alert ('Veuillez entrer votre adresse e-mail de contact.');}
	
	// Verification de la syntaxe email	
	else if (!(ereg(document.form_insc.contact_email.value,mask1))){	
		alert ('Veuillez saisir une adresse e-mail correcte.');}
		
	// Verification du champ nom equipe
	else if (document.form_insc.olympiades_nom_equipe.value ==""){ 
		alert ('Veuillez entrer le nom de votre équipe.');}
	
	// Verification du champ nom equipe
	else if (document.form_insc.olympiades_nombre_participants.value ==""){ 
		alert ('Veuillez entrer le nombre de participants.');}

	// Verification du champ nom equipe
	else if (document.form_insc.concours_musique_nom_groupe.value ==""){ 
		alert ('Veuillez entrer le nom de votre groupe.');}
	
	// Verification du champ nom equipe
	//else if (document.form_insc.concours_musique_nombre_participants.value ==""){ 
	//	alert ('Veuillez entrer le nombre de participants de votre groupe.');}

	// soumission du formulaire ne jamais effacer
	else{
		document.form_insc.submit();
	} 	
}

function ereg(str, mask){	
	if  (str.search(mask) != -1)
	return true;	
	else return false;
}